Our office staff spent quite as much time while on the audit because did, bring our books forward, submitting every dang invoice by means of past transfer pricing several years for his scrutiny.<br><br>I've had clients ask me to make use of to negotiate the taxability of debt forgiveness. Unfortunately, no lender (including the SBA) is actually able to do such an issue. Just like your employer ought to be needed to send a W-2 to you every year, a lender is required to send 1099 forms for all borrowers in which have debt understood. That said, just because lenders need to send 1099s doesn't suggest that you personally automatically will get hit having a huge tax bill. Why? In most cases, the borrower can be a corporate entity, and an individual might be just a personal guarantor. I realize that some lenders only send 1099s to the borrower. Effect of the 1099 on your personal situation will vary depending on kind of entity the borrower is (C-Corp, S-Corp, LLC, etc). The best way you can do so is to fill the internal revenue service form 982: Reduction of Tax Attributes Due to release of Indebtedness. Alternately, place also attach a letter alongside with your tax return giving an end break of the total debts as well as the total assets that you would have. If you don't address 1099-C from the IRS, the irs will file a  Lien and actions seem taken anyone in form of interests and penalties become be very painful!
